Pool Chemical Balance Nutting Lake MA Importance of Chemical Balance

Ensuring the right chemical balance is vital for swimmer safety and pool health. Correct chemical levels stop algae and bacteria growth, ensure clear water and protect pool surfaces and equipment.

- Optimal pH Balance: Your pool's pH level indicates its acidity or alkalinity. A balanced pH level should be between 7.2 and 7.6. Acidic water from low pH can irritate skin and corrode equipment. High pH levels make the water alkaline, leading to cloudiness and scaling. Frequent pH testing and adjustments is vital for swimmer comfort and safety.

- Managing Chlorine Concentration: Chlorine is essential for pool hygiene, as it kills bacteria, algae, and other harmful microorganisms. The proper chlorine level is between 1-3 ppm. Insufficient chlorine results in unsanitary conditions, promoting bacteria and algae growth. Too much chlorine can cause skin and eye irritation and create a strong chlorine smell. Frequently checking and balancing chlorine levels ensures effective sanitation and swimmer comfort.

Balancing Alkalinity

Total alkalinity plays a vital role in pool water balance. Alkalinity acts as a buffer for pH levels, helping to prevent drastic changes in pH. The ideal range for total alkalinity is between 80-120 ppm.

- Stabilizing pH Levels: Balanced alkalinity stabilizes pH levels, preventing rapid changes that can cause skin irritation and damage to pool surfaces. If alkalinity is too low, pH levels can fluctuate wildly, making it difficult to maintain a consistent balance. If alkalinity is too high, it can make the water cloudy and lead to scaling. Regularly testing and adjusting alkalinity levels is vital for a balanced and stable pool.

- Calcium Hardness Control: Calcium hardness measures the dissolved calcium in water. The ideal range for calcium hardness is between 200-400 ppm. Low calcium levels result in corrosive water, harming surfaces and equipment. Excessive calcium causes scaling and water cloudiness. Regularly testing and adjusting calcium hardness is important for protecting your pool and ensuring clear water.

Using Pool Chemicals Safely

Proper handling and storage of pool chemicals is essential for both safety and effectiveness. Chemicals should be stored in a cool, dry place, away from direct sunlight, children, and pets. Follow the manufacturer's instructions for correct dosing and application.

- Accurate Chemical Measurement and Mixing: Accurately measuring pool chemicals is essential to maintain the proper balance. Inaccurate dosing can disturb chemical balance and water quality. Use a clean, dry measuring cup or scoop and never combine chemicals directly. Mix chemicals in water if required, following the instructions carefully.

- Understanding Chemical Reactions: Some pool chemicals can react dangerously when mixed. For example, chlorine and acid should never be mixed. Understanding these interactions avoids accidents and ensures safe use. Store chemicals separately and handle each with care to prevent harmful reactions.

Keeping your pool's chemical balance is crucial for safety, cleanliness, and enjoyment. By consistently testing and adjusting pH, chlorine, alkalinity, and calcium, you maintain optimal water conditions.

 Proper chemical use and storage enhance the health and safety of your pool.
